【Comfortable Sitting Experience】The ergonomic office chair with high back is designed to fit the body curves. High-density sponge filled cushion is overwhelmingly soft that you won’t get tired after long-time sitting. The soft lumbar support pillow is specifically for sedentary officers to relieve the pain on the lower back.
【Lockable Reclining Function】Push the lever up and down to lock or unlock the backrest, available for 90-135 degrees of tilt. Collaborate with a retractable footrest, the reclining office chair surely provides a super cosy lunchtime break spot, not only comfy enough for work, but also suitable for reading, game-playing and a short napping.
【Multifarious Adjustment】The height of this 360° swivel desk chair could be easily adjusted by the pneumatic gas cylinder that rises and lowers smoothly and silently. The flexible headrest of the computer chair can also be adjusted up and down, back and forth, as you like to reduce cervical pressure.
【High Quality】Featuring breathable mesh material, the ergonomic desk chair can reduce heat and sweating while the high-density cushion is deformation-resistant for longer use. Padded armrests provide for snug elbow support.
【Solid Construction】Our comfy mesh office chair with 360-degree swivel caster could run smoothly whether on tilt, wooden floors, carpets or other flooring. The strong 5-point base ensures excellent durability and stability with the maximum weight up to 250 pounds.

I’ll start with the positives about this chair:1. The internal structure and bolts of this chair are sturdy and *most components have a nice weight to them.2. The chair itself is very comfortable and has made sitting for longer periods much more enjoyable and easier on my back and joints.3. It’s a cute chair! I have the green one and it matches my other furniture and decor.4. The fabric is breathable and reclining is very cozy. It’s a comfy chair!The bad:1. The wheels. Wow these casters are terrible – they constantly fall off and it’s VERY annoying. They don’t affix to the bottom part of the chair and it’s a massive design flaw. You have to perfectly balance on it for the wheels to stay in place. I will probably use some epoxy to permanently attach them to the bottom because this is incredibly annoying.2. Slight squeaks – I’m not the heaviest person and fall within the range stated on the listing so not sure what that’s about but overall it feels sturdy.3. The *back cover to hide the bolts is the cheapest plastic ever – it also does not stay in place properly and fell off repeatedly. I’ll probably just glue this into place as well which is kind of ridiculous.A partial refund due to the terrible lack of wheel attachment and faulty back cover is something I will look into.Overall, this is a good chair and worth it if you’re looking for something with reclining functionality.Caveats:If you are above 5’5” this chair will not be comfortable for you, particularly in the reclining position. If you don’t care about reclining, it will probably still be comfortable for you to sit in.If you have a carpet under your desk, invest in a chair mat because you will lose your mind with the crappy wheels otherwise. The only reason they stay on at all is because I have a fiberglass chair mat over my carpet.

I’ve had this chair in my office for 3.5 months and use it daily as my work is remote. I have it set up at an “L” layout desk with multiple monitors and computers, where I swivel regularly depending on what I’m focused on. The setup was pretty easy, and the materials seemed good quality when first removed from the box. Below are my observations after a relatively short amount of time for an office chair.Pros:The chair is comfortable, and the recline with foot rest function is nice. (It’s comfortable enough for a nice nap.)The casters (wheels) are actually pretty good. I usually swap these out for roller blade style wheels, but these are doing ok for now.Cons:The woven cover on the arm rests and seat is thin and snags easily on pretty much anything that isn’t smooth. When it snags, it pulls and tears easily.The chair is noisy. Every time I move around on the chair it creaks and makes snapping sounds from the various joints. I’m not a big guy (5’9″ 210 lbs) so this is surprising.The right arm where it attaches to the seat works itself loose every couple of weeks. I don’t mind having to tighten bolts every now and then, but this is excessive. I would throw some locktite on it, but I don’t want to mess up the mechanism that allows the chair to recline. It seems like the bushings in the joints are not as flexible as they should be, which then causes stress on the bolts. (Biggest issue)Final opinion – good design, ok execution. For the price, though, I can’t complain.I will most likely either add a cushion or get a cover for the seat and try to push some of the snagged threads back in with a needle.
